Swimming and Diving Among the Nation's Best
Article compares and swimmer's best times and list the schools in order based on improvement
A recent article posted by SwimSwam Magazine (www.swimswam.com) listed the Blue Devils as one of the most best team's in the country when it came to an improvement over their previous best times, prior to the Northeast Conference meet in 2019.
The article, titled, WHO GOT FASTER? IMPROVEMENT AT WOMEN'S D1 CONFERENCE MEETS, which published on March 15, compared a swimmer's previous best time in an event, and matched those times with their times from their conference meet in 2019.
According the article the Blue Devils dropped a median time drop of -0.5 percent, the 25th best performance in the country among all Division I teams. The Blue Devils had 27 swims measured and 67% of those were faster than the previous best time.
